Touring cycling routes around Oulton are characterized by the gentle, rolling landscape of rural Norfolk. The region features a network of quiet country lanes, riverside paths, and trails through historic estates. Elevations are generally low, making for accessible cycling experiences.

Best touring cycling routes around Oulton

  • The most popular touring cycling route is Blickling Estate Forest Trails – Blickling Hall loop from Itteringham, a 7.0 miles (11.3 km) trail that takes 42 minutes to complete, winding through the scenic forest trails of the Blickling Estate.
  • Another top favourite among local touring cyclists is The River Bure – Coltishall Station loop from Aylsham, an easy 15.7 miles (25.4 km) path. This route follows the course of the River Bure, offering tranquil waterside views.
  • Local touring cyclists also love the Blickling Tower – Blickling Estate Forest Trails loop from Blickling, a 4.0 miles (6.5 km) trail leading through the historic Blickling Estate and its woodlands, often completed in about 26 minutes.

Coltishall Station is one of the narrow gauge stations on the Bure Valley Railway line. It's also an access point for the nine mile (14.5 km) Bure Valley Path.

The Bure Valley Railway is a heritage railway offering a nostalgic trip by steam on Norfolk’s longest narrow gauge railway, between the historic market town of Aylsham and bustling town of Wroxham, at the heart of the Norfolk Broads. The Whistlestop Café on the station is open to visitors who aren't planning a train ride. The one-way journey to Wroxham takes about 45 minutes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es around Oulton?

Touring cycling routes around Oulton are characterized by the gentle, rolling landscape of rural Norfolk. You'll primarily find quiet country lanes, dedicated riverside paths, and trails winding through historic estates. Elevations are generally low, ensuring a comfortable ride for most cyclists.

Are there any challenging touring cycling routes for experienced riders?

While Oulton is known for its gentle terrain, there are some routes that offer a bit more distance and elevation gain for experienced touring cyclists. For instance, the Marriott's Way – Marriott's Way loop from Cawston is a moderate 17.9 miles (28.8 km) route with over 140 meters of elevation gain, providing a longer and more engaging ride.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see along the cycling routes?

The Oulton area is rich in history and natural beauty. Along your rides, you might encounter historic sites like Baconsthorpe Castle or charming religious buildings such as All Saints Church, Gresham and St Agnes' Church, Cawston. The Marriott's Way also offers a scenic path to explore.
